Banking Operations Across Regional Markets
The company conducts banking activities primarily through Centennial Bank, delivering financial services to customers across Arkansas, Florida, Texas, Alabama, New York, and additional regional markets. Services include checking and savings accounts, certificates of deposit, residential and commercial mortgages, construction lending, agricultural lending, and treasury management solutions.
Commercial banking remains a significant component of operations, serving businesses across real estate, healthcare, hospitality, manufacturing, agriculture, and professional services. Consumer banking complements these activities through personal lending, online banking, debit card services, and mobile financial platforms.

Lending Portfolio and Business Segments
Loan diversification represents an important aspect of operations. Lending categories include commercial real estate, residential real estate, construction financing, agricultural lending, consumer lending, and specialized commercial finance.
Marine lending has developed into one specialized business area, serving recreational and commercial vessel financing customers across multiple regions. Additional lending activity includes investor real estate financing and business lending supporting local commercial enterprises.
Deposit gathering remains another core operational component. Retail deposits, commercial deposits, money market accounts, certificates of deposit, and treasury management services support banking operations while providing customers with a broad range of financial products.
The business also provides trust and wealth management services, expanding beyond traditional banking activities into fiduciary administration, estate services, and asset management offerings.

July 2026 Earnings Schedule
Home BancShares (NYSE:HOMB) is scheduled to announce quarterly financial results on July 15, 2026. Public expectations published before the announcement indicate quarterly earnings per share of approximately $0.61, while the company has also declared a regular quarterly cash dividend of $0.21 per share.
Quarterly earnings releases typically provide updated information regarding loan balances, deposit growth, net interest margin, asset quality, non-interest revenue sources, operating expenses, and capital levels.
